Four Italian silver boxes, Mario Buccellati, circa 1960

Description

  • all signed M. BUCCELLATI
  • silver
  • length of first 4 1/2 in.
  • 11.5 cm
all with matted surfaces, one engraved with a view of the Colosseum, another with a view of the Arch of Constantine, one with two horse heads under glass, the last a double snuff box

Condition

horse box with difficulty closing, snuff box with minor scratches to exterior, otherwise good
